Job Description
Insight Global is seeking a Central Distribution &
Inventory Supervisor for a large healthcare client. This individual will oversee inventory and distribution operations across a multi-building hospital campus, ensuring critical medical supplies are ordered, stocked, and delivered accurately at all times. The supervisor will manage union staff in a fast-paced, 24/7 environment, handle midnight supply deliveries, coordinate with vendors, and serve as a key point of contact for nursing units. This role is highly hands-on, requiring frequent rounding, strong communication skills, and the ability to flex between inventory and distribution leadership to support patient care operations.
Working Hours (4 Days Total - 40 hr work week):
Weekend (2 days): 12-hour shift 12:00 PM – 12:00 AM
Weekdays (2 days): 8-hour shifts (8:00 AM – 4:00 PM)

Required Skills & Experience
Bachelor's degree in Supply Chain or related field
5 years of warehouse/inventory management experience
1+ year of supervisory experience
Experience in a union/1199 environment
Proficiency in Microsoft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int)
Nice to Have Skills & Experience
Experience in a hospital system
Experience with PeopleSoft, Oracle, or inventory control software Certifications such as CMRP or IAHCSMM
